Noun: unneighborliness  ,ún'ney-bur-lee-nus
Usage: US (elsewhere: unneighbourliness)
  1. An unneighborly disposition
    "Their unneighborliness was evident in their refusal to participate in community events";
    - unneighbourliness [Brit, Cdn]

Type of: unfriendliness

Antonym: good-neighborliness [US]
